Transaction 75260289ec617b874f985e6cda3887b54ee0174813597f687c6598e271e1d94e
1 Input
1 Output
-
75260289ec617b874f985e6cda3887b54ee0174813597f687c6598e271e1d94e:0
- value
- 198568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24311b93f6fe51b8e5d3061862f85eed83e5cddd OP_EQUAL
- address
- 34zP5WnNfEZkzL9dPaCG9N9dR8fAxTb6RM